Milky Chance Releases New Album Living In A Haze

June 2024 · 4 minute read

Kassel, Germany-based duo Milky Chance recently dropped their brand-new album, Living In A Haze, via Muggelig Records. Milky Chance is currently on an extensive tour across the U.S. and Canada.

Talking about the new album, Milky Chance shares, “We stepped out of our comfort zone to make this album. It was freeing and felt like a new chapter for us. We gave ourselves the space and energy to really dive deep into writing and producing, tried out new things, worked with incredible collaborators like Charlotte Cardin and Fatoumata Diawara, and created what we think is a colorful and diverse album.”

Along with topping the charts in multiple countries, crowning Billboard’s charts, and sell-out tours, Milky Chance has released popular singles such as “Colorado,” “Synchronize,” and “Living In A Haze,” as well as two mix tapes, amassing more than 5.5 billion streams.

Encompassing a dozen tracks, highlights on Living In A Haze include the title track, opening gleaming colors flowing into a contagious rhythm topped by dreamy vocals and layers of glistening harmonics, with psychedelic-like breakdowns.

Blending surf-pop flavors with hints of alt-rock and hip-hop, “Colorado” reveals lush washes of harmonics and lusciously languid vocals, imbuing the lyrics with alluring surfaces.

With its syncopated, reggae rhythm, “Flicker In The Dark,” features the evocative voice of Malian singer-songwriter Fatoumata Diawara. The feel and flow of the tune sways and ripples with creamy textures, giving the song a tasty, tropical sensation.

“Feeling For You” rides a thumping kick-drum, topped by shimmering synths and quixotic vocals. The rolling impression of the tune produces a mesmerizing groove, low-slung and infectiously seductive. While “History Of Yesterday,” featuring Charlotte Cardin, merges savors of hip-hop and R&B into an alluring rhythm as plush harmonies infuse the lyrics with nostalgic aromas.

With Living In A Haze, Milky Chance delivers an innovative album, drenched in their unique, tantalizing signature sound.
